00:13:36
Speaker 1: Yeah, roads are shut down, Tens of thousands of people are without power. Governor Newsom has declared a state of emergency in several major I think it's Los Angeles, Orange Riverside, San Bernardino, San Diego, and Shasta Counties. That Shasta Counties. That is a significant swath of southern California. And it's that atmospheric river that we've talked about before. And it's just dumping one to one and a half inches of rain per hour on some of those areas that were scarred from the fires. So the mud slide threat is there and real, and it's just tough, tough weather to have on this holiday.

00:14:12
Speaker 2: They actually have legit not just evacuation warnings. They have evacuation orders in some places out there, telling people they need to get out of there. That's that's awful for Look you look out the window and see it's raining, and that kind of sucks on a Christmas Day, but it's dangerous.

00:14:26
Speaker 1: Yeah, the trees that are falling too. I know you've seen some of the photos. But not only do you have the soaking rain, but they've got these winds. I saw Santa Monica had like a forty mile per hour gust. The hills in Venture I had a seventy mile per hour gusts. That's tropical storm force winds right there, isn't it.

00:14:43
Speaker 2: Yeah, I think that is that and I can remember amount of meteorologist, So I don't I can explain how it all comes together, Robes. But the atmospheric river. We have been covering a few of the mountain California in the past couple of years. And the best example. It sounds crazy, but a imagine a water hose in the sky dumping water instead of spreading it around. Right, it's dumping in one place. That is what they call an atmospheric river. And that's happening in the southern California. It's supposed to happen or go through all day to day. Yeah, and I think not to the weekend where they finally get some relief. That's tough.
